Consensus Among VALORANT Players: One Rank Stands Out as Significantly More Toxic

Toxic Players in VALORANT: Which Rank Takes the Crown?

In every multiplayer game, toxic players seem to be a common presence, and VALORANT is no exception. However, according to the game’s community, there is one specific rank that stands out as the most filled with toxic individuals.

Ascendant: The Reign of Toxicity

During a Reddit discussion on August 15th, a player asked which rank in VALORANT is the most notorious for toxic players. Many immediately pointed to Ascendant, the third highest rank in the game. They also provided valid reasons to support their claim.

Players stated that when individuals achieve a decently-skilled rank, particularly Ascendant, their egos skyrocket. As one player put it, “The higher you are, the more toxic. Think about it, in Iron/Bronze, you’re lucky to have two teammates with mics. But in Asc/Imm, some players lack game sense despite their rank and believe they’re the next TenZ.”

A Glimpse into the Discussion

However, players also highlighted that high ranks like Radiant, considered the best in the game, don’t have as many toxic players. This might be because streamers, content creators, and professional players populate these ranks, and they tend to be more relaxed. One of the top comments suggested, “They’re more chill because they’re a small refined cast of people.”

Debunking the Myth

While it’s widely believed that low ranks have the most toxic players in various multiplayer games, such as Bronze and Silver in VALORANT and League of Legends, or Silver and Gold in CS:GO, some players disagreed. They pointed out that most players in these ranks don’t even use in-game communication and are generally easy-going.
